Two children were taken to the hospital after a fire at a Lehigh Acres home early Friday morning.
According to the Lee County Sheriff’s Office, a fire broke out at a home on Hightower Avenue around 1:30 a.m.
Both victims suffered burns on their legs, according to LCSO. Additionally, there are no fatalities.
Gulf Coast News was at the scene and saw damage in the garage.
LCSO said the fire does not appear to be suspicious.
